Adidas Nitecrawler Pack Revealed - New Predator, X, Nemeziz and Copa
A new 'Black Pack' is here, courtesy of Adidas. Confirming the previous leaks, the 'Nitecrawler' collection was unveiled today, bringing with it new stealth colorways for the Adidas Predator, X, Nemeziz and Copa silos.
Adidas Nitecrawler Pack
This image shows the Adidas Copa, Predator, Nemeziz and X boots from the Nitecrawler pack.
All Adidas Nitecrawler 2018 football boots feature understated, almost entirely black colorways. Only a few select elements on every boot are colored in grey, such as brandings or the polka dot pattern on the X. The '+' editions stand out by featuring chrome metallic sole plate, a nice touch to set them apart from the rest.

As mentioned above, the Adidas Nitecrawler collection is available to buy from today, 1 March 2018. There will be no on-pitch support, i.e. the likes of Dybala, Messi and Pogba will continue to sport the boots form the previous collection, the Cold Blooded pack.

Exclusive: Manchester United 26-27 Third Kit Pays Homage to Salford Lads Club
The Manchester United 2026-2027 third kit is is a homage to the local Salford area, specifically drawing inspiration from the iconic Salford Lads Club.
The kit is inspired by the two Lancashire roses prominently featured on the club's entrance signage, a visual made famous by its inclusion in The Smiths' 1986 album, The Queen is Dead. It incorporates hand-drawn roses and features a unique back neck sign-off, celebrating both the local fan base and the youth community deeply associated with the historic Salford landmark.
Awful? Adidas Launches Women's 'Reconstructed Bringback' 1994 Kits
Adidas has officially introduced a unique new lifestyle range with the launch of its 'Reconstructed Bringback' collection. Focused heavily on women's fashion, this latest release takes two iconic international football shirt designs from the 1990s and transforms them into modern, streetwear-ready silhouettes.
For this drop, the sportswear brand has completely reimagined the highly memorable 1994 kits worn by the national teams of Germany and Spain, adapting the classic patterns into entirely new apparel formats.
The Spain entry in the collection offers a significant structural departure from a standard football jersey, arriving as an asymmetrical, one-shoulder top. The garment maintains the classic red base of the original 1994 home shirt, complete with the instantly recognizable column of navy blue and yellow interlocking diamonds running down the right side.
For the German national team, Adidas has transformed the legendary 1994 World Cup home kit into a fitted, square-neck tank top. The classic DFB crest and retro Adidas branding are positioned lower down on the torso.
